Added
- Added a strength reduce pass to eliminate 256/128 bit multiply, division,
and modulo where possible.
- Visual Studio Code extension can download the Solang binary from github
releases, so the user is not required to download it themselves
- The Solana target now has support for arrays and mapping in contract
storage
- The Solana target has support for the keccak256(), ripemd160(), and
sha256() builtin hash functions.
- The Solana target has support for the builtins this and block.timestamp.
- Implement abi.encodePacked() for the ethereum abi encoder
- The Solana target now compiles all contracts to a single `bundle.so` BPF
program.
- Any unused variables, events, or contract variables are now detected and
warnings are given, thanks to [LucasSte](https://github.com/hyperledger-labs/solang/pull/429)
- The `immutable` attribute on contract storage variables is now supported.
- The `override` attribute on public contract storage variables is now supported.
- The `unchecked {}` code block is now parsed and supported. Math overflow still
is unsupported for types larger than 64 bit.
- `assembly {}` blocks are now parsed and give a friendly error message.
- Any variable use before it is given a value is now detected and results in
a undefined variable diagnostic, thanks to [LucasSte](https://github.com/hyperledger-labs/solang/pull/468)
Changed
- Solang now uses LLVM 12.0, based on the [Solana LLVM tree](https://github.com/solana-labs/llvm-project/)
Fixed
- Fix a number of issues with parsing the uniswap v2 contracts
- ewasm: staticcall() and delegatecall() cannot take value argument
- Fixed array support in the ethereum abi encoder and decoder
- Fixed issues in arithmetic on non-power-of-2 types (e.g. uint112)
